R-10.6 - Right to Information and Protection of Privacy Act

Full text
Representations to the Ombud
2019, c.19, s.6
71(1)During an investigation, the Ombud shall give the following persons an opportunity to make representations to the Ombud:
(a) if the person who made the complaint is the applicant, the applicant and the head of the public body concerned;
(b) if the person who made the complaint is a third party who is given notice of a decision under section 36, the third party, the applicant and the head of the public body concerned; and
(c) any other person the Ombud considers appropriate.
71(2)Despite the opportunity to make representations, the persons referred to in subsection (1) shall not be entitled to be present during an investigation or to have access to or to comment on representations made to the Ombud by another person.
71(3)The Ombud may decide whether representations are to be made orally or in writing.
71(4)Representations may be made to the Ombud through counsel or an agent.
